The PIC16F18876T-I/PT is a microcontroller belonging to the PIC16 family of microcontrollers produced by Microchip Technology. The PIC16F18876T-I/PT microcontroller offers the following key specifications: - High-performance RISC CPU - Up to 32 KB Flash program memory - Up to 1 KB RAM - Integrated analog-to-digital converter (ADC) - Enhanced Universal Synchronous Asynchronous Receiver Transmitter (EUSART) - Various communication interfaces (I2C, SPI, etc.) - Multiple timers and PWM modules - Operating voltage range: 1.8V to 5.5V - Temperature range: -40°C to 125°C

The functional features of the PIC16F18876T-I/PT include: - Versatile digital and analog I/O capabilities - Enhanced communication interfaces for data exchange - Flexible and precise timing control through integrated timers and PWM modules - Efficient power management options for low-power operation - Robust security features to protect code and data integrity
The PIC16F18876T-I/PT operates based on the principles of embedded control, utilizing its integrated CPU, memory, and peripherals to execute programmed tasks and interact with external devices or systems.
The PIC16F18876T-I/PT is well-suited for a wide range of applications, including: - Consumer electronics: Remote controls, smart home devices, wearable gadgets - Industrial automation: Control systems, monitoring devices, sensor interfaces - Automotive systems: Engine control units, dashboard displays, lighting control - Medical devices: Patient monitoring equipment, diagnostic tools, portable instruments
Some alternative models to the PIC16F18876T-I/PT include: - PIC16F18875T-I/PT: Similar features with different memory configurations - PIC16F18877-I/PT: Higher pin count with expanded peripheral set - PIC16F18878T-I/PT: Enhanced analog and communication capabilities

What is the maximum operating frequency of PIC16F18876T-I/PT?
- The maximum operating frequency of PIC16F18876T-I/PT is 32 MHz.
Can PIC16F18876T-I/PT be used in battery-powered applications?
- Yes, PIC16F18876T-I/PT can be used in battery-powered applications as it has low power consumption features.
What are the communication interfaces supported by PIC16F18876T-I/PT?
- PIC16F18876T-I/PT supports SPI, I2C, and UART communication interfaces.
Is PIC16F18876T-I/PT suitable for motor control applications?
- Yes, PIC16F18876T-I/PT is suitable for motor control applications with its integrated PWM modules.
Does PIC16F18876T-I/PT have analog-to-digital conversion capabilities?
- Yes, PIC16F18876T-I/PT has built-in ADC modules for analog-to-digital conversion.
Can PIC16F18876T-I/PT be programmed using C language?
- Yes, PIC16F18876T-I/PT can be programmed using C language with MPLAB XC8 compiler.
